    What is Dr. Sean Sliman's specialty?

    Dr. Sliman is a Interventional Cardiologist near Columbus, OH. A branch of medicine within cardiology that employs advanced imaging and diagnostic techniques to assess blood flow and pressure in the coronary arteries and heart chambers.     Is this Dr. Sean Sliman aff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Sliman is affiliated with Mount Carmel St. Ann's, Ohiohealth Riverside Methodist Hospital, Mount Carmel East, Mount Carmel Grove City which are a Castle Connolly Top Hospitals.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
